State govt to join in Karnival Jom Heboh next month in youth approach — Exco

By Norrasyidah Arshad

SHAH ALAM, May 20 — The state government will participate in Karnival Jom Heboh, organised by Media Prima Berhad, for the first time ever when it runs from June 2 to June 4.

State executive councillor for young generations Mohd Khairuddin Othman said the programme, which will take place Stadium Shah Alam’s square from 10am to 12am, will be officiated by Menteri Besar Dato’ Seri Amirudin Shari.

“This cooperation (with Media Prima) is one way in which to approach the youths. Simultaneously, we feel the carnival is capable of forming a civilized society via the organisation of activities centred around family and sports.

“Throughout the programme, we will also promote and publicise all the schemes and policies provided by the state government over the years,” he told SelangorKini yesterday.

Mohd Khairuddin added the three-day Karnival Jom Heboh will also see the participation and cooperation of several other quarters, including the Shah Alam City Council, Pengurusan Air Selangor Sdn Bhd, and Yayasan Kebajikan Atlet Kebangsaan.

“Some of the activities which will be featured at the carnival include street football tournaments, self-defence demonstrations, netball, street music competitions, and food festivals,” he said.
